英文摘要
DESCRIPTION
This proposal seeks to determine the mechanism of C-inactivation associated
with voltage-gated K channels in T-lymphocytes. The first aim of the
project is to test the hypothesis that interactions among the subunits of
the tetrameric channel responsible for inactivation is cooperative. This
hypothesis will be evaluated from changes in the time course of inactivation
in heterologous expressed heteromultimeric channels assembled from wild-type
and mutant subunits with different defined stoichiometries. Best fits of
the data to mathematical models will be used to distinguish between
different alternatives. The second aim of the study seeks to determine
which regions of the subunits participate in the inactivation. Of
particular focus is the role of the S1-S2 loop. Molecular biology
techniques will be used express channels in which this region has been
modified. Mathematical modeling of the expressed current and construction
of free energy profiles for transitions between conformational states will
lead to a description of a role for this region in C-inactivation.
